Forum » Programiranje » Težave z UnitTesti za connectionString v ASP aplikaciji
Težave z UnitTesti za connectionString v ASP aplikaciji
brinovcek ::
Pozdravljeni,
Spravu sem se delat seminarsko za faks v ASP-ju in moram v okviru aplikacije narediti tudi unit teste, katere pa ne znam glih. Za začetek sem poskušal testirat funkcijo ki vrne objekt SQLConnection string z connection stringom vendar pa mi nikakor ne rata da bi test uspel pa ne vem zakaj... prosim za pomoč.
moja koda:
kje bi lahko bila napaka oz kaj delam narobe ?
Spravu sem se delat seminarsko za faks v ASP-ju in moram v okviru aplikacije narediti tudi unit teste, katere pa ne znam glih. Za začetek sem poskušal testirat funkcijo ki vrne objekt SQLConnection string z connection stringom vendar pa mi nikakor ne rata da bi test uspel pa ne vem zakaj... prosim za pomoč.
moja koda:
************Baza.cs***************************
using System;
using System.Collections.Generic;
using System.Configuration;
using System.Data.SqlClient;
using System.Linq;
using System.Web;
namespace TKseminarska
{
public class Baza
{
/**
* "ApplicationServices"
*/
internal static SqlConnection connectToDB(string connectionName)
{
SqlConnection myConnection = new SqlConnection();
myConnection.ConnectionString = ConfigurationManager.ConnectionStrings[connectionName].ConnectionString.ToString();
return myConnection;
}
}
}
*************unit test za Baza.cs*********************
[TestMethod()]
[HostType("ASP.NET")]
[AspNetDevelopmentServerHost("C:\\Users\\matjaz\\documents\\visual studio 2010\\Projects\\TKseminarska\\TKseminarska", "/")]
[UrlToTest("http://localhost:50073/")]
public void connectToDBTest()
{
string connectionName = "ApplicationServices";
SqlConnection expected = new SqlConnection();
expected.ConnectionString=@"data source=.\SQLEXPRESS;Integrated Security=SSPI;AttachDBFilename=|DataDirectory|\aspnetdb.mdf;User Instance=true";
SqlConnection actual;
actual = Baza.connectToDB(connectionName);
Assert.AreEqual(actual,expected);
Assert.Inconclusive("Verify the correctness of this test method.");
}
kje bi lahko bila napaka oz kaj delam narobe ?
Vredno ogleda ...
| Tema | Ogledi | Zadnje sporočilo | |
|---|---|---|---|
| Tema | Ogledi | Zadnje sporočilo | |
| » | C# težavaOddelek: Programiranje | 4236 (3082) | mladec |
| » | SQL problemOddelek: Programiranje | 1847 (1465) | win64 |
| » | C# INSERT statment ne vpise podatkovOddelek: Programiranje | 1328 (1202) | darkolord |
| » | [C#] DATA GRID VIEWOddelek: Programiranje | 2063 (1943) | Kekec |
| » | [C#] Query in codeOddelek: Programiranje | 1933 (1677) | iggy1 |